Frequently Asked Questions about Winnetka
How much are Studio apartments in Winnetka?
There are currently 465 Studio Apartments in Winnetka with rent ranges from $1,245 to $3,822 with an average price of $1,866.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Winnetka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Winnetka ranges from $1,250 to $4,553 with an average monthly rent of $2,294.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Winnetka c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Winnetka range from $1,698 to $6,238.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,006.
How expensive are Winnetka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 250 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Winnetka on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,929 to $5,587 - averaging $3,740 for the location.
